Course Details

• Understanding Conduct Disorder: Definition, Prevalence, and Causes
• Identifying Conduct Disorder in the Classroom: Recognizing Symptoms and Behaviors
• Strategies for Managing Conduct Disorder in the Classroom: Creating Structure and Establishing Rules
• Positive Reinforcement and Consequences for Conduct Disorder: Building Good Behavior and Reducing Challenging Ones
• Collaborating with Parents and Professionals: Building a Supportive Team for Students with Conduct Disorder
• Social Skills Training for Students with Conduct Disorder: Developing Empathy, Communication, and Conflict Resolution Skills
• Therapeutic Interventions for Conduct Disorder: Cognitive Behavioral Therapy, Family Therapy, and Mindfulness Practices
• Creating a Safe and Inclusive Classroom Environment for Students with Conduct Disorder
• Legal and Ethical Considerations in Working with Students with Conduct Disorder
• Self-Care for Educators Working with Students with Conduct Disorder: Avoiding Burnout and Maintaining Boundaries
